WebDec 5, 2013 · For example: It has been two months since I last spoke English. Okay, now here is the summary, or take-away, from this review: Use FOR to talk about a period (or duration) of time. Use SINCE to talk about the starting point of a period of time (that continues, or went on for some time, but has now stopped). Also remember that ‘for’ and ... WebMar 18, 2024 · So what are the main differences between since and from ? From can be used with any tense, since only with the perfect tenses; From is followed by other propositions; since (usually) isn’t; From is usually used to indicate a finished action; since refers to an unfinished action WebThe word ‘since’, on the other hand, refers to a particular point of time from when the action started/began in the past to the present. It indicates that the action is continuing. For …
